Webgenesys Acquired by HAT and TXT

HAT, through its Technology Fund 5, along with TXT e-solutions, has fully acquired Webgenesys for a total of 63 million euros. In this acquisition, TXT obtained 84.1% while HAT secured the remaining 15.9%. Sellers Genesy Group, founded by Antonello Posterino and Raffaele Primo, will retain some involvement to ensure business continuity. Genesy Group will also receive 15.7 million euros in TXT shares as part of the transaction. The acquisition strengthens Webgenesys’ leadership in providing digital solutions for public administration, with expectations to further drive innovations in the sector. The deal was supported by several advisors, including Grant Thornton for financial diligence and OC&C for business strategy, highlighting the strategic nature of the investment. With a CAGR of 33% over the last five years, Webgenesys reported 2023 revenues of 31.5 million euros, aiming for 37 million euros in 2024. The closing of the deal is expected by the end of 2024.

Financials

  • 63 million euros – The total value of the acquisition of Webgenesys by HAT and TXT.
  • 15.7 million euros – Amount paid in TXT shares to Genesy Group as part of the acquisition.
  • 31.5 million euros – Webgenesys' revenue for 2023.
  • 22% – EBITDA margin for Webgenesys in 2023.
  • 37 million euros – Projected revenue for Webgenesys in 2024.
  • 200 million euros – Value of public contracts awarded to Webgenesys for 2025-2028.
